+declare_clippy_lint! {
+ /// ### What it does
+ /// Checks for null function pointer creation through transmute.
+ ///
+ /// ### Why is this bad?
+ /// Creating a null function pointer is undefined behavior.
+ ///
+ /// More info: https://doc.rust-lang.org/nomicon/ffi.html#the-nullable-pointer-optimization
+ ///
+ /// ### Known problems
+ /// Not all cases can be detected at the moment of this writing.
+ /// For example, variables which hold a null pointer and are then fed to a `transmute`
+ /// call, aren't detectable yet.
+ ///
+ /// ### Example
+ /// ```rust
+ /// let null_fn: fn() = unsafe { std::mem::transmute( std::ptr::null::<()>() ) };
+ /// ```
+ /// Use instead:
+ /// ```rust
+ /// let null_fn: Option<fn()> = None;
+ /// ```
+ #[clippy::version = "1.67.0"]
+ pub TRANSMUTE_NULL_TO_FN,
+ correctness,
+ "transmute results in a null function pointer, which is undefined behavior"
+}
